MLS Series Portable Top-Loading Autoclave

A lab sterilizer is essential to good laboratory practice, particularly in biotechnology, pharmaceutical and clinical laboratories. Of all sterilization methods, high pressure steam (autoclave) is the most widely used because of its efficacy, speed and reliability. The PHCbi MLS Series portable top-loading autoclave provides a safe, reliable high-pressure steam sterilizing environment within a self-contained unit that is easy to use. These reliable, energy saving autoclaves are ideal for a wide range of applications.

PHCBI - MLS Series 2.6 cu.ft. Portable Top-Loading Autoclave

Ergonomic Design – Portable and Freestanding
Improved compact design allows for flexible placement, while the large chamber offers capacity of up to 8-12 flasks (1L).

Programmable Functions
These lab autoclaves allow maximum flexibility for the sterilization of laboratory equipment and media. Select from 12 preset programs or configure your own based on individual facility needs.

Microprocessor Control
The state-of-the-art microprocessor delivers precise temperature control (115°C-135°C) with one-touch operation. It also notifies user of each step of the sterilization process via prerecorded voice messages.

Compact Design
This space-saving autoclave maximizes the use of available floor space, while still providing ample capacity for storage within the 14.6″ chamber. The large chamber offers greater capacity with a storing example load of 8-12 1,000 ml flasks.

Processor Voice Notification
This lab sterilizer includes voice notification of the system process. Each step of the process is notified via a prerecorded voice message, allowing the end user to hear the process as it is happening.

Optional Process Printer
An optional built-in process printer for bath documentation is available. The printer prints out the process run results of temperature, pressure, vs. time. Each printout is date and time stamped.

Swing-Up Lid
The swing-up lid opens the chamber for 100% access. It eliminates side space requirements.

Double Interlocking Structure
To ensure the safe operation of the high temperature, high-pressure lab autoclave, the chamber and the open/close level are controlled by a double interlock system. This system is dependent on temperature and pressure sensors, which ensure safety levels before opening the autoclave.
